This subcontract, issued by the Department of Defense through Mschq Norfolk, requires the military-compliant packaging, crating, and preparation of an oil priming pump for shipment. All work must strictly adhere to DOMANUAL and MIL-STD standards to ensure the equipment is properly secured and marked for transport. The opportunity is categorized under NAICS code 493130 and was posted on August 24, 2026. Interested parties must submit their responses by the deadline of August 28, 2026, at 2:00 PM.

USNS ROBERT F KENNEDY MTA FY27
Solicitation # N3220526R6051
The USNS ROBERT F KENNEDY (T-AO 208) Mid-Term Availability (MTA) for Fiscal Year 2027 is being procured under solicitation N3220526R6051, issued by the Department of Defense through the Mschq Norfolk office in Norfolk, Virginia, with a NAICS code of 336611. This is a Total Small Business Set-Aside as defined under FAR 19.5, restricting eligibility to small business concerns only. Proposals must be submitted via the Procurement Integrated Enterprise Environment (PIEE) portal by the deadline of June 30, 2026, and only firms that have executed a Corporate Principal-signed Non-Disclosure Agreement (NDA) may access the technical data and computer software necessary to prepare their offers. The work scope involves preparing for and executing the mid-term availability of the USNS ROBERT F KENNEDY with performance scheduled between February 22 and April 5, 2027, at a contractor facility located on the East or Gulf Coast due to operational and national security requirements. Access to technical information is governed by strict controls aligned with DoDI 5230.24 and DoD-M 5200.01-V4, requiring organizational security measures, compliance with all export regulations, and flow-down NDA requirements for any subcontractors. The contractor must maintain controls subject to audit and is obligated to return or destroy all technical data upon contract completion or award to another entity, with written certification of destruction required within 30 days. No contract value, pricing, inspection criteria, or detailed performance specifications are provided in the available documentation, and no contract administration or evaluation factors are included in the solicitation materials.
